QUOTE(nscid @ Jul 11 2014, 02:04 PM)
Hi guys...pls advice me on these tints. which to choose. Either 3M or HO. If 3M i ll go for Crystalline 70 (front) & Nano40 (side & rear) while for HO is Ser60 (front) & Ceramic40 (side & rear). At first I wanna go for HO but SA told me its a bit expensive because the IRR is 80-83% compares to IRR99% for 3M. Any suggestion? Pricing is almost similar

user posted image

user posted image
*
Go for 3M since Nano40 is a safety film and more worth it. (Since pricing is almost same)
Your HO package is non-security film.

Finally give both tint a walk-in visit, so you can know more.
